#14e43a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#14e43a is composed of 7.8% red, 89.4% green and 22.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.6%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 131 degrees, a saturation of 83.9% and a lightness of 48.6%. #14e43a color hex could be obtained by blending #28ff74 with #00c900.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#14e43a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#14e43a has RGB values of R:20, G:228, B:58 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.75,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 1369146.
